Output 91ec20f7797e16bb084b625f9e3a20b4c3ac75958a4d3104281e633319d03243: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cac715a637d5190f69b35b1a7deccac4f1acf252 OP_EQUAL
address
3LBCuvzfwZo7dQnNC3Hd44VUBgNHVnkXiD
transaction
91ec20f7797e16bb084b625f9e3a20b4c3ac75958a4d3104281e633319d03243
confirmations
171674
spent
true